The climate of Sapapali'i
Located in the South Pacific, within the tropical region of
Samoa,
Sapapali'i carries with it the characteristics of a tropical rainforest climate, designated as Af under the Köppen climate classification system. This indicates a humid, warm environment with substantial rainfall throughout the year, lacking a distinct dry period.
Temperatures remain consistent all year round, varying only marginally. High temperatures range from 27.3°C (81.1°F) to 28.7°C (83.7°F), while low temperatures fluctuate from 26°C (78.8°F) to 27.6°C (81.7°F), providing an inexplicably stable climate. Factor in a relative humidity persistently around the mid to high 70s and it becomes apparent that this is a place of consistent heat.
Rainfall averages vary more notably, yet nonetheless, maintain a constant presence. Values span from 57mm (2.24") to 175mm (6.89"). Days with observed precipitation keep within a consistently higher number, fluctuating from 18.7 days to 22.7 days each month.
An interesting note about Sapapali'i is the consistency of daylight hours. The range is narrow, from 11.3 hours to 12.9 hours. Correspondingly, hours of sunshine do not deviate excessively either, oscillating between 7.3 hours and 8.7 hours. Winds manifest themselves all year round, with their speeds intensifying from 14.8km/h (9.2mph) to 24.7km/h (15.3mph).
The best time to visit Sapapali'i
Despite the consistent climate in
Sapapali'i, there are some months that might be more favorable to visitors seeking certain conditions. If less rainfall is a preference, then
September should be treatment as the best period due to its minimum average rainfall, 57mm (2.24") across 18.7 days. This month, as well as
October and
November also have slightly elevated temperatures of just above 27.5°C (81.5°F) allowing for warmth without overwhelming humidity.
The worst time to visit Sapapali'i
Though the temperatures remain reasonably consistent year-round, the precipitation patterns in
Sapapali'i do vary more substantially.
January and
February see the highest levels of rainfall, with averages of 175mm (6.89") and 155mm (6.1") respectively. Those visiting during these months should be prepared for heavy precipitation. On top of that, January is one of the windier months with gusts of wind up to 25.5km/h (15.8mph).
